引言
前端编程是当今互联网开发中不可或缺的一部分,它涉及到网站和应用的视觉和交互设计。对于想要入门前端编程的人来说,了解如何快速成长是一条充满挑战但同样充满机遇的道路。本文将为您揭示入门者如何从零开始,轻松掌握前端编程,并实现快速成长。
第一部分:前端编程基础
1.1 了解前端编程的基本概念
前端编程主要涉及HTML、CSS和JavaScript三种技术。HTML用于构建网页的结构,CSS用于美化网页的外观,JavaScript用于实现网页的动态交互。
1.2 学习HTML
HTML(HyperText Markup Language)是网页内容的基础。学习HTML时,您需要掌握:
- 网页的基本结构
- 标签的使用
- 表单和多媒体元素
- 页面布局(如表格、框架、浮动布局等)
1.3 学习CSS
CSS(Cascading Style Sheets)用于控制网页的样式和布局。学习CSS时,您需要了解:
- 选择器
- 布局(如Flexbox和Grid)
- 颜色和字体
- 响应式设计
1.4 学习JavaScript
JavaScript是一种脚本语言,用于增加网页的交互性。学习JavaScript时,您需要掌握:
- 变量和数据类型
- 控制结构(如条件语句和循环)
- 函数
- 对象和数组
- DOM操作
第二部分:前端开发工具和环境搭建
2.1 安装开发工具
- 文本编辑器:如Visual Studio Code、Sublime Text等,用于编写代码。
- 浏览器:Chrome或Firefox,用于测试网页效果。
2.2 配置开发环境
- 安装Node.js和npm(Node.js包管理器),用于管理JavaScript库和框架。
- 学习使用版本控制工具,如Git,以便跟踪代码变更和协作。
第三部分:实践与项目构建
3.1 开始小项目
通过构建小项目来实践所学知识。例如,可以尝试制作一个简单的个人博客、待办事项列表或天气应用。
3.2 学习框架和库
前端框架和库(如React、Vue、Angular)可以帮助您更高效地开发。选择一个框架,并跟随教程进行学习。
3.3 构建完整项目
尝试构建一个完整的前端项目,从设计到实现,再到部署。这将帮助您将所学知识整合起来。
第四部分:持续学习和成长
4.1 阅读文档和教程
不断学习最新的前端技术和最佳实践。
4.2 参与社区
加入前端开发社区,如Stack Overflow、GitHub和Reddit中的前端相关板块,与其他开发者交流。
4.3 实践和反思
通过不断实践和反思,提高自己的编程技能。
结语
前端编程是一门实践性很强的技术,通过不断的学习和实践,您可以逐步掌握前端编程,并在这一领域实现快速成长。记住,成功的关键在于持续学习和不断的实践。祝您在前端编程的道路上一帆风顺!
